| IntroductionOsteoarthritis is a frequent disease in orthopedics.Accompany with the increment that the world advanced age turns population in recent years,the OA morbility rate also presents to year by year rise of trend.OA's really cause of disease don't be clear, profusion of different opinions,among them,the matrix metalloproteinases(MMPS) and tissue inhibitor of matrix metalloproteinases(TIMPS) is valued by the medical science field day by day.The cataplasia of articular cartilage has been being thought to is an OA sign.Current research expresses that the osteoarthritis causes by a radicle quality outside the joint cartilage cell to synthesize and decline a solution disequalibrium,MMPs/TIMPs comparison the maladjustment is one of the main reasons for making the cataplasia of articular cartilage.We chose the matrix metalloproteinase-7(MMP-7),the matrix metalloproteinase-9(MMP-9),the tissue inhibitor of matrix metalloproteinase-3(TIMP-3),to use immunity methods to study the expression of them in osteoarthritis patients' synovium of knee joint,strengthen thus the earlier period to this kind of sufferer to diagnose and cured in early days.Material and MethodsThe histological changes of Synovium of knee joint by hematoxyllin-eosin staining and immunohistochemical expression and tunel staining method of MMP-7, MMP-9,TIMP-3 in osteoarthritis1 were studied in 30 osteoarthritis cases and 30 normal controls.All data were statistically analyzed by variance and correlation analysis.Clinical dataThe synovium come from the patients who are operated in our hospital.All the cases were final diagnosed by our hospital's department of orthopaedics and image. Among the total,the OA patients have 30 cases,they are the process group.Their age was from 48~75.Their synovium was remained when they accepted the arthroscope operation.The control group was non-OA cases,also 30 cases.There are 4 cases of synovium syndrome,20 cases of menisci injury,6 cases of ACL or PCL injury.Their synovium was also remained when they accepted the arthroscope operation.The research methodThe synovium were deal with NS water flush in one hour after the operation,to be cut by 1.0cm×0.8cm×0.5cm,then they were deal with the process of the formalin fixation,the paraffin imbedding,5μm slice.Observe the synovium apoptosis cell.The other sheets were deal with immunohistochemical staining.Observe them by microscope,choose ten eye-reach(400X) using the eye glass graticule micrometer,do the positive cell counting in every 100cell eye-reach,express them by general average and standard deviation.ResultsThe Immunohistochemical expression of MMP-7,MMP-9,TIMP-3 in the osteoarthritis patients' synovium of knee joint is more higher than the expression in the normal synovium.They are obviously difference(p<0.05).Histology consequenceFrom the result display,we can see that the normal synovial tissue of joint don't show the chronic inflammation reaction,the synovial cell distribute regulately,they don't obviously hyperplasy.The micrangium constit and the amph-tissue don't have obviously patho-change.But the OA knee synovium of joint show the chronic inflammation reaction,infiltrated a lot of achroacyte and histoleucocyte distributed by blood vessel.The synovial cell have the accrementition.The accremention show the corpora mammillaria and the fluffiness.The blood vessel hyperplasia is obvious.The monolayer blood vessel endothelium cell cellular swelling,lumen of blood vessel narrowing,the peripheral vessels fibrosis,hyalinization,chondrometaplasia.The immunohistochemical resultThe MMP-7,MMP-9,TIMP-3 are high positive express in the synovial cell,the histoleucocyte,achroacyte,the vassular endothelial ande the metaplastic cartilage.The endochylema are buffy.And in the normal synovium tissue they also have a little express.But the total statistics consequence show that the positive cell rate is obviously different with the control cell rate,P<0.05.ConclusionThe abnormal expression of MMP-7,MMP-9,TIMP-3 in the in osteoarthritis patients' synovium of knee joint was likely to be the more important index of diagnosis. |
